About Robert Dimenstein

Robert Dimenstein is the Head of Sales at BoomPop, having previously held significant roles at Crayon, where he managed a $15M+ Annual Recurring Revenue portfolio and achieved notable revenue growth. He holds a Bachelor's Degree in Economics from Brandeis University and has extensive experience in sales and business development across various companies.

Background in Sales Management

Prior to his current position, Robert Dimenstein held various roles at Crayon, where he progressed from Manager of Enterprise Sales to Head of Enterprise Sales and Account Management. His tenure at Crayon included significant achievements, such as managing a $15M+ Annual Recurring Revenue portfolio and doubling the Annual Recurring Revenue from $5M to $10M.

Professional Experience at IANS

Robert Dimenstein worked at IANS in multiple capacities, including Business Development Associate and Senior Account Executive. His time at IANS spanned from 2014 to 2017, during which he developed skills in account management and sales strategy, contributing to his overall expertise in the field.

Achievements at Crayon, Inc.

At Crayon, Robert Dimenstein achieved notable milestones, including a $3.5M increase in new business and a 68% rise in average contract value in FY 2022. He also established the first Account Management and Partnerships and Alliances program, which led to a $1M increase in upsell revenue.
